One of the two new hotels planned for Niceville is under construction on John Sims Parkway at the former location of Tisa’s restaurant and motel.
The new Holiday Inn Express and Suites will be located at 410 John Sims Parkway West. It is part of a retail complex that reportedly will include shopping and dining. The center is being developed by Huff Homes.
Another hotel, TownePlace Suites by Marriott, is planned for the southwest corner of Highway 85 North and Niceville Avenue, just south of Generations Church. It will have 79 rooms.
The hotel is being developed by Optimal Hospitality Solutions of Fort Walton Beach. According to its website, the Niceville TownePlace Suites will be complete in 2019.
